I'm pretty skeptical about this whole line of inquiry.  We've only got
three kinds of joins, and each one of them has quite a bit of bespoke
logic, and all of this code is pretty performance-sensitive on large
join nests.  If there's a way to make this work for KaiGai's use case
at all, I suspect something really lightweight like a hook, which
should have negligible impact on other workloads, is a better fit than
something involving system catalog access.  But I might be wrong.

I also think that there are really two separate problems here: getting
the executor to call a custom scan node when it shows up in the plan
tree; and figuring out how to get it into the plan tree in the first
place.  I'm not sure we've properly separated those problems, and I'm
not sure into which category the issues that sunk KaiGai's 9.4 patch
fell.  Most of this discussion seems like it's about the latter
problem, but we need to solve both.  For my money, we'd be better off
getting some kind of basic custom scan node functionality committed
first, even if the cases where you can actually inject them into real
plans are highly restricted.  Then, we could later work on adding more
ways to inject them in more places.
